Gov Mohammed approves participation of Bauchi in 2025 Ogun sports festival

By Samuel Luka,
Bauchi
Governor Bala Mohammed of Bauchi state has granted approval for the participation of the state in the 2025 22nd National Sports festival in Ogun state.
The deputy governor of the state, Rt. Hon. Mohammed Auwal Jatau stated this on Saturday when he received athletes, coaches and officials from the National Sports Commission on a solidarity visit at the government house, Bauchi.
The Deputy Governor while appreciating the governor for the approval, noted that, preparations have been concluded to ensure that Bauchi state’s athletes participate fully and excel in the festival.
According, the state’s participation in the National Sports Festival since its inception in 1976 has consistently showcased talents in athletics, boxing, football and other key sports disciplines with securing a number of medals for the state.
The deputy governor expressed delight over the visit during which he received the Torch of Unity for the 22nd National Sports Festival tagged “Gateway Games 2025”.
The receiving of the torch is traditionally, the symbol of Unity, peace, friendship and tolerance among Nigerians.
He commended the National Sports Commission and the festival committee for creating a platform that fosters youth development, talent discovery and national integration.
Earlier speaking, an official of the National Sports Commission, Mrs Mbora Ikana, commended Governor Bala Mohammed for his administration’s investment in sporting activities, and promised continued support of the Commission to Bauchi to excel in sporting events.
